What unique cultural aspect of Kolkata do you believe distinguishes it from other cities in India?

 One unique cultural aspect of Kolkata that distinguishes it from other cities in India is its rich literary heritage and intellectual fervor. Kolkata, often referred to as the "City of Joy," has long been recognized as a hub of literature, arts, and intellectual discourse. Several factors contribute to Kolkata's distinct literary and cultural identity:

  1. Literary Legacy: Kolkata has a deep-rooted literary tradition that dates back centuries. The city has been home to renowned poets, writers, and intellectuals who have significantly contributed to Indian literature. Figures like Rabindranath Tagore, Bankim Chandra Chattopadhyay, Sarat Chandra Chattopadhyay, and Satyajit Ray have left an indelible mark on literature and culture not only in India but also internationally.

  2. Coffee House Culture: Kolkata's iconic coffee houses, such as the historic Coffee House on College Street, have served as gathering places for intellectuals, artists, and students for decades. These establishments have been venues for passionate discussions, debates, and literary exchanges, fostering a culture of intellectual curiosity and camaraderie.

  3. Cultural Festivals and Events: Kolkata hosts several cultural festivals and events throughout the year that celebrate literature, arts, and intellectual pursuits. The Kolkata Literary Festival, Kolkata International Film Festival, and Kolkata Book Fair are just a few examples of events that attract intellectuals, writers, and artists from around the world, showcasing the city's vibrant cultural scene.

  4. Educational Institutions: Kolkata is home to prestigious educational institutions such as Presidency University, Jadavpur University, and the University of Calcutta, which have nurtured generations of scholars, writers, and thinkers. These institutions have played a pivotal role in shaping Kolkata's intellectual landscape and fostering a culture of academic excellence and inquiry.

  5. Language and Literature: Bengali literature holds a prominent place in Kolkata's cultural milieu. The Bengali language, with its rich literary heritage, poetry, and prose, is deeply intertwined with the city's identity. Kolkata's streets are adorned with bookstores, literary societies, and cultural centers that promote the Bengali language and literature
